Karwar to Bijapur

Updated: 20 May 2026

Bijapur, now known as Vijayapura, is located about 420 km from Karwar, accessible via the NH 63 and NH 50 highways. The route takes you through the heart of Karnataka. The journey typically takes 10 to 11 hours by bus. Bijapur is known for its historic monuments, including the world-famous Gol Gumbaz, and its rich Islamic heritage.

Total Distance: 420 km by road, 330 km straight-line.
Fastest Way
Private taxi, taking about 10 hours.
Cheapest Way
KSRTC bus, costing approximately 600 INR.

Things to Do in Bijapur
1
Gol Gumbaz
A world-famous monument known for its massive dome and unique acoustic properties.
2
Ibrahim Rauza
A beautiful tomb and mosque complex, known for its intricate architecture.
3
Malik-e-Maidan
A massive cannon, one of the largest in the world, located in the Bijapur Fort.
4
Bara Kaman
An unfinished mausoleum known for its unique architectural design.
